Specialist terrorism officers seized the suspected firearm and ammunition after a search of a car.

A number of police searches are being carried out in Londonderry after specialist terrorism officers found a suspected gun during a stop and search of a car.

One man, aged in his 50s, has been arrested after members of the PSNI's Terrorism Investigation Unit recovered the firearm and ammunition. The search, part of an ongoing investigation, was carried out on the Letterkenny Road, near the Brandywell area, at about 18:45 BST."We believe this suspected firearm could have been potentially used in a violent attack - with the aim of killing or, at the very least, causing serious injury," said Supt Willy Calderwood.
